Overview

What XPRIZE does: It designs, launches, and runs large-scale competitions to solve major global challenges, using crowd-sourced, scientifically viable solutions and prize incentives to drive progress. How its product works: The organization creates competitions with clear goals, sets rules and timelines, invites participants around the world to submit solutions, and awards prizes to successful entrants. The process turns diverse ideas into vetted projects that can be scaled and shared widely. How it differs from competitors: Instead of offering traditional funding or building a single product, XPRIZE formalizes a competition-based model that harnesses open participation and prize incentives to accelerate discovery, aiming for broad, equitable impact rather than a single proprietary solution. What the company’s goal is: To inspire and empower humanity to achieve breakthroughs that accelerate a hopeful, abundant future for all.

AgelessRx wins $1M XPRIZE Healthspan award to advance healthy ageing clinical trial

AgelessRx, a longevity-focused telehealth platform, has been named one of 10 Milestone 2 awardees in the $101 million XPRIZE Healthspan competition, receiving a $1 million award. The company was selected from over 600 global teams competing to develop therapeutics that restore muscle, cognition, and immune function to extend healthy life in adults aged 50–90. AgelessRx earned its place after completing a 90-day randomised, placebo-controlled pilot study evaluating combinations of gerotherapeutics alongside lifestyle support. The study enrolled 26 adults aged 60–80. For the final phase, AgelessRx plans to conduct a one-year randomised controlled trial involving approximately 186 adults. Final trials will run between 2026 and 2029, with XPRIZE expected to award a grand prize of up to $81 million in 2030.

Michigan startup advances in $119M XPRIZE Water Scarcity competition with gravity-driven desalination system

Archimedes-Desal, a Royal Oak, Michigan-based team, will participate in Extended Team Testing for Track A of the $119 million XPRIZE Water Scarcity competition. The team is the only Michigan-based qualifier in the global challenge addressing water access for over 2 billion people worldwide. The team's gravity-driven reverse osmosis system has received recognition from international desalination experts, an XPRIZE grant award and a US patent. Founder Tom Wither noted the team will compete against major corporations and research institutes. Archimedes-Desal has established a GoFundMe campaign to bridge a funding gap. Supporters will receive invitations to a post-competition award ceremony if the team wins prizes ranging from $5 million to $40 million. The working full-scale demonstration is currently being assembled in Royal Oak.

Project InnerSpace and XPRIZE announce collaboration to design landmark geothermal surface systems prize.

Project InnerSpace and XPRIZE announce collaboration to design landmark geothermal surface systems prize. Mar 24, 2026, 08:00 ET The prize aims to accelerate innovation in integrated geothermal surface systems while driving supply chain transformations needed to accelerate scaled deployment of geothermal HOUSTON, March 24, 2026 /PRNewswire/ - Project InnerSpace, the leading independent research organization focused on accelerating geothermal energy, and XPRIZE, the world's leader in designing and operating large-scale incentive competitions to solve humanity's grand challenges, today announced a collaboration to design a major incentive prize targeting breakthroughs in integrated geothermal surface plant systems, including turbo-machinery and other surface system components. The prize design, funded by Project InnerSpace, aims to catalyze the innovation and supply chain transformation needed to accelerate deployment and unlock the next phase of geothermal growth at scale. The collaboration comes as geothermal stands at a critical inflection point. While significant progress has been made in subsurface technologies and drilling, surface systems are emerging as a key constraint on deployment speed, cost, and replicability. As outlined in Project InnerSpace's March 2026 report, Spinning Up, Not Out: Scaling the Turbo-machinery Supply Chain for Rapid Geothermal Deployment, turbo-machinery remains a central bottleneck, with limited manufacturing capacity, long lead times, and highly customized designs poised to slow the pace of project development as geothermal scales. A Prize Designed to Unlock Scale The planned XPRIZE is being developed to address these structural bottlenecks directly by encouraging more modular, integrated, and high-performance geothermal surface plant architectures that can operate efficiently across real-world geothermal conditions and be deployed more rapidly at scale. Rather than narrowly focusing on a single component, the evolving design is aimed at surfacing solutions that lower costs, cut lead times and improve flexibility, manufacturability, and ease of deployment. This broader systems framing reflects what the design team has gathered through interviews with manufacturers, developers, and technical experts: many of today's geothermal surface systems are still highly customized, creating long lead times, slowing project delivery, and limiting opportunities for supply chain learning. In many cases, the current market does not reward the type of risk-taking needed to pursue more transformative designs. At the same time, turbo-machinery performance is deeply coupled with the broader surface plant. Heat exchangers, cooling systems, and other balance-of-plant components account for a substantial share of cost and directly impact overall system efficiency and deployment timelines. Addressing turbo-machinery in isolation is unlikely to unlock the full step-change needed for rapid geothermal scale-up. The prize is intended to create a lower-pressure, high-visibility pathway for research, development, and demonstration that can accelerate innovations the market is not yet set up to deliver on its own. Through the prize design process, the team is also exploring how to avoid over-constraining the solution space. Rather than prescribing a single technology pathway, the competition is expected to focus on performance-based outcomes that leave room for different approaches, including innovations in turbines, working fluids, heat exchange systems, and other integrated surface plant configurations. The goal is to identify designs that can deliver competitive system performance across a range of operating conditions, while enabling step-change improvements in standardization, manufacturability, transportability, and deployment speed. Prize Design Discussions at CERAWeek 2026 Project InnerSpace and XPRIZE will convene key stakeholders this week at CERAWeek 2026 in Houston to advance the prize design process. Discussions will take place in two venues: in the Innovation Agora, where the collaboration will be featured among the conference's most forward-looking energy technology showcases, and in Geothermal House, where dedicated discussions will bring together geothermal developers, turbo-machinery manufacturers, and investors to help shape the prize's design, eligibility criteria, and judging framework. These sessions will directly engage the ecosystem of actors whose coordination is essential to success: OEM manufacturers who can scale domestic production, project developers who need reliable and timely equipment supply, investors seeking standardized bankable hardware, and federal policymakers working to build resilient domestic clean energy supply chains. The Urgency Behind the Prize Two recent Project InnerSpace publications provide the evidentiary foundation for this prize. Spinning Up, Not Out: Scaling the Turbo-machinery Supply Chain for Rapid Geothermal Deployment documents current turbo-machinery supply chain constraints in detail - the concentrated OEM landscape, the 12 to 18-month lead times, the logistics barriers created by oversized international shipments, and the coordination failures that prevent manufacturers from investing in new capacity. Minding the Gap: Geothermal Finance at Oil and Gas Scale illuminates the broader financing landscape, showing how surface plant cost and schedule risk directly constrains the capital structures available to geothermal developers. Together, these reports make the case that targeted, incentive-based intervention - rather than incremental market development alone - is needed to compress the timeline to geothermal scale. The prize design process will be informed by input gathered at CERAWeek and beyond, with a formal prize structure announcement expected later in 2026. Timeline Secures Usd 250K At Xprize Healthspan Competition

Swiss longevity start-up Timeline has been named a Milestone 1 Award Winner in the prestigious XPRIZE Healthspan competition. Selected from hundreds of international teams, Timeline is one of the Top 40 global teams advancing approaches to extend healthy human function by at least a decade. As a Milestone 1 Award Winner Timeline receives USD250k and will compete for a place in the final.Global life expectancy has more than doubled in the last 100 years, but the quality of our health as we age has not increased at the same rate. In the U.S. there is currently a 12-year gap between life expectancy and healthy life expectancy, or the period of life free of major chronic disease or disability. Launched in November 2023, the USD 101M XPRIZE Healthspan is the first health-focused competition of its kind, incentivizing teams to develop proactive, accessible therapeutic solutions that restore muscle, cognition, and immune function by a minimum of 10 years, with a goal of 20 years, in persons aged 50-80 years, in one year or less.From over 600 registered teams across 58 countries, the Top 100 teams are recognized as semi-finalists, with the Top 40 Healthspan teams selected as Milestone 1 award winners based on their proposed therapeutic solution, scientific rationale, supporting evidence, strengths of team and clinical centre, and proposals for clinical testing
